Syngenta Juveniles Football Club

Syngenta Juveniles Football Club is a registered charity in Scotland working in the advancement of public participation in sport, the provision of recreational facilities, or the organisation of recreational activities, with the object of improving the conditions of life for the persons for whom the facilities or activities are primarily intended, based in Falkirk.

Quick answer

Syngenta Juveniles Football Club is a registered charity (number SC055342) on the Office of the Scottish Charity Regulator (OSCR) register, so it is a legitimate, regulator-overseen organisation. It is registered for: the advancement of public participation in sport; the provision of recreational facilities, or the organisation of recreational activities, with the object of improving the conditions of life for the persons for whom the facilities or activities are primarily intended. What the charity does

4 The organisation’s purposes are:- (a) The advancement of public participation in football for players of all ability levels throughout the local community. (b) The development in football of all participating players and officials (c) the provision of recreational facilities, or the organisation of recreational activities (d) Provide a positive, safe and, where applicable, provide a non competitive environment to play development football.
